Only by recognizing fishing rights that are socially sensitive and address the issues of labour, gender and human rights, can fishing communities, especially small-scale, traditional ones, be assured of social justice in the face of moves towards ecological and resource sustainability. These are some of the issues discussed in this dossier, which is a collection of articles from SAMUDRA Report, the triannual publication of the ICSF.
